#206323 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#206323 is composed of 12.5% red, 38.8%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.6%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 122.7 degrees, a saturation of 51.1% and a lightness of 25.7%. #206323 color hex could be obtained by blending #40c646 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#206323 color description : Very dark lime green.
#206323 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#206323 has RGB values of R:32, G:99,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 2122531.

Shades and Tints of #206323
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a04 is the darkest color, while #fafd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#206323
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e453f is the less saturated color, while #028107 is the most saturated one.
